ono- (07_Describing Location in Asaxi)


ono-

ono-

Grammatical function

  • Type: Attainable Locative Prefix
  • Function: Attainable Locative
  • Meaning: “Somewhere (reachable)”, “A specific place (not here but accessible)”, “Within range”.

Logic & Etymology

o (Here) + no (There).

  • Lit: “Here-There.”
  • Logic: A location that is defined by the path between “here” and “there.” It is not unknown (), nor is it far away (ko). It is a “somewhere” that can be reached.

Syntax

Attaches to the front of the noun.

  • Structure: ono-[Noun]

Pronunciation

IPA: /ono/

Pitch Accent

  • Morae: o · no
  • Pattern: L · L
  • Class: atonal
